#include "clar_libgit2.h"
#include "git2/sys/transport.h"
static git_transport _transport = GIT_TRANSPORT_INIT;
static int dummy_transport(git_transport **transport, git_remote *owner, void *param)
{
*transport = &_transport;
GIT_UNUSED(owner);
GIT_UNUSED(param);
return 0;
}
void test_transport_register__custom_transport(void)
{
git_transport *transport;
cl_git_pass(git_transport_register("something", dummy_transport, NULL));
cl_git_pass(git_transport_new(&transport, NULL, "something://somepath"));
cl_assert(transport == &_transport);
cl_git_pass(git_transport_unregister("something"));
}
void test_transport_register__custom_transport_error_doubleregister(void)
{
cl_git_pass(git_transport_register("something", dummy_transport, NULL));
cl_git_fail_with(git_transport_register("something", dummy_transport, NULL), GIT_EEXISTS);
cl_git_pass(git_transport_unregister("something"));
}
void test_transport_register__custom_transport_error_remove_non_existing(void)
{
cl_git_fail_with(git_transport_unregister("something"), GIT_ENOTFOUND);
}
void test_transport_register__custom_transport_ssh(void)
{
const char *urls[] = {
"ssh://somehost:somepath",
"ssh+git://somehost:somepath",
"git+ssh://somehost:somepath",
"git@somehost:somepath",
};
git_transport *transport;
unsigned i;
for (i = 0; i < ARRAY_SIZE(urls); i++) {
#ifndef GIT_SSH
cl_git_fail_with(git_transport_new(&transport, NULL, urls[i]), -1);
#else
cl_git_pass(git_transport_new(&transport, NULL, urls[i]));
transport->free(transport);
#endif
}
cl_git_pass(git_transport_register("ssh", dummy_transport, NULL));
cl_git_pass(git_transport_new(&transport, NULL, "git@somehost:somepath"));
cl_assert(transport == &_transport);
cl_git_pass(git_transport_unregister("ssh"));
for (i = 0; i < ARRAY_SIZE(urls); i++) {
#ifndef GIT_SSH
cl_git_fail_with(git_transport_new(&transport, NULL, urls[i]), -1);
#else
cl_git_pass(git_transport_new(&transport, NULL, urls[i]));
transport->free(transport);
#endif
}
}
